Location: Milliken Live Oak Plant - LaGrange, Georgia
Reports To: Engineering Services Manager

Job Summary
The Engineering Services Engineer is responsible for ensuring that production machinery and supporting systems operate safely, reliably, and efficiently. This role involves troubleshooting, maintaining, and improving physical infrastructure and control systems, as well as leading or supporting engineering projects focused on performance and reliability improvements.
